MySQL插入与查询命令详解及PHP操作指南

0 下载量 190 浏览量 更新于2024-08-31 收藏 79KB PDF 举报
本文将深入解析MySQL中插入和查询数据的相关命令及其在PHP脚本中的应用。MySQL是一种广泛使用的开源关系型数据库管理系统,其强大的数据处理能力使得它在Web开发中不可或缺。本文主要关注以下几个关键知识点: 1. **插入数据**: - INSERTINTOSQL语句是MySQL中用于向数据表中插入数据的标准操作。该语句的基本结构包括: - `INSERT INTO table_name (field1, field2, ... fieldN)`:指定要插入数据的表名以及列名。 - `VALUES (value1, value2, ... valueN)`:提供对应字段的值,如果是字符型数据,需用单引号或双引号括起来。 2. **命令行操作**: - 在MySQL的命令提示窗口(`mysql>`)中,用户可以通过键入SQL命令执行插入操作。例如,向`tutorials_tbl`表中插入数据的示例展示了如何设置数据库、选择数据库、定义要插入的字段和值,并确认每条记录是否成功插入。 3. **PHP脚本操作**: - 除了命令行交互,本文还提到了使用PHP与MySQL进行交互的方法。通过PHP,开发者可以编写程序化的代码来批量插入数据,提高效率。这通常涉及到建立数据库连接,执行SQL语句,以及处理可能的错误和结果。 4. **日期和时间处理**: - 对于时间戳的插入,`NOW()`函数用于获取当前系统时间,如`NOW()`和`'2007-05-06'`都是合法的时间值。 5. **注意事项**: - 提示符如`->`并不是SQL语句的一部分,但它们用于演示和清晰地表示SQL语句的各个部分。 理解并熟练掌握这些命令和语法对于MySQL初学者和高级用户来说都非常重要,无论是日常的数据维护还是开发过程中处理数据输入,都能提高工作效率。在实际项目中,确保数据的安全性和一致性也是不容忽视的部分,比如处理NULL值、避免SQL注入等。